#637ecf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#637ecf is composed of 38.8% red, 49.4%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 60%. #637ecf color hex could be obtained by blending #c6fcff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#637ecf color description : Moderate blue.

#637ecf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#637ecf has RGB values of R:99, G:126,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 6520527.

Shades and Tints of #637ecf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030409 is the darkest color, while #f9f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#637ecf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9296a0 is the less saturated color, while #3466fe is the most saturated one.
